Renowned Bollywood playback singer Monali Thakur faced a health scare during a live performance at the Dinhata Festival in Cooch Behar, West Bengal. Struggling to breathe mid-performance, Monali was forced to halt the show, apologizing to the audience for her inability to continue.
Monali Thakur Falls Ill During Live Show
On Tuesday evening, the singer was performing to an enthusiastic crowd when she suddenly felt unwell. In a viral video from the event shared on Facebook, Monali is seen addressing the audience before leaving the stage. “I sincerely apologise to you. I am very sick today. The show was on the verge of getting cancelled,” Monali can be heard saying in the clip.
Following the incident, Monali was initially taken to Dinhata Sub-District Hospital before being transferred to a private hospital in Cooch Behar for further treatment. Reports confirm that the singer is currently undergoing treatment and recovering.
Recent Controversy in Varanasi
This health episode comes shortly after Monali Thakur made headlines for a separate incident earlier this month in Varanasi, Uttar Pradesh. The singer walked off stage midway during a performance, citing harassment and mistreatment by the event management team.

Addressing the allegations in an Instagram post, Monali spoke out against the exploitation and mistreatment of vendors, backstage crews, and artist coordinators by the organizers. “It is absolutely unacceptable to treat vendors poorly, cheat them of their hard-earned money, or con them in any way,” she wrote. Monali also shared an apology letter from the organizers, highlighting the resolution of the issue.
Monali Thakur’s Legacy in Bollywood
Monali Thakur, known for her melodious voice and hit songs like Sawar Loon, Zara Zara Touch Me, and Chham Chham, has been a prominent figure in the Indian music industry. Apart from her musical career, she has also showcased her acting prowess in the critically acclaimed Nagesh Kukunoor film Lakshmi, where she played the titular role.
